About the Company

Founded in 1871, Degroof Petercam is a Belgian-rooted reference investment house built on more than 150 years of integrated financial knowledge. Private and institutional investors, as well as corporates trust us for our strong investment convictions and for our continuum of services in private banking, asset management, investment banking and fund servicing.
On December 31, 2023, total assets amounted to 74 billion euros. More than 1,500 experts are committed to our clients through offices in Belgium, Luxembourg, France, Switzerland, Spain, the Netherlands, Germany, Italy, Hong Kong and Canada. As employer and investor, we create responsible prosperity for all by opening doors to opportunities and accompanying our clients with expertise.
Degroof Petercam is owned by Indosuez Wealth Management and by its historical minority shareholder CLdN Cobelfret. Degroof Petercam benefits from the vast expertise and international network of Indosuez and the Crédit Agricole group, the world's 9th largest bank (The Banker, 2024).

Context

Buy-Side Fixed Income Credit Analyst covering the Banking sector

The seven fundamental analysts and two ESG analysts of the buy-side fixed income research team have as main objectives to provide the fund managers with full and in-depth analysis on micro issues (specific analysis on credit spreads, fundamental, financial and ESG analysis, looking behind ratings provided by agencies and challenging them). Their work is essentially bottom-up and complements the top-down analysis done by the fund managers.

Within the team, the analyst covering banks will perform a fundamental analysis of the bond issuer’s business profile (swot analysis, industry risk, regulation and macro) integrating Environmental, Social and Governance aspects into the analysis with the support of the two ESG analysts. This analysis of the business profile is then complemented by a financial analysis (using the CAMELS methodology which focuses on capital, asset quality, management, earnings, liquidity and sensitivity) in order to determine the capacity of the issuer to repay its debt, in time and entirely. Finally, the structure of each bond is analysed: statutory, contractual or structural subordination, non-call and coupons risk, etc.
